Energy: Prices

Department for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y written question – answered on 31st January 2023.

Alert me about debates like this

Photo of Beth Winter Beth Winter Labour, Cynon Valley

To ask the Secretary of State for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y, pursuant to the oral contribution of the Minister on 23 January 2023, whether his Department has proposed specific levels of additional credit and debt forgiveness that energy suppliers have been asked to consider to help consumers in payment difficulties.

Photo of Graham Stuart Graham Stuart Minister of State (Minister for Climate)

The Department has not proposed specific levels of additional credit and debt forgiveness. I discussed matters related to support for energy customers on prepayment meters with stakeholders, including energy supply companies, at a roundtable on Wednesday 25 January.
